Software Engineer Visa Sponsorship Jobs: Software engineer visa sponsorship jobs continue to expand as companies across the world compete for skilled tech professionals. Businesses in the United States, United Kingdom, Canada, Australia, Germany, and other tech-driven economies are actively hiring international software engineers and offering visa sponsorship to fill critical talent gaps. From backend engineering to cloud development and full-stack roles, demand remains strong across startups, multinational companies, and enterprise organizations.
Technology powers nearly every industry, including finance, healthcare, e-commerce, logistics, and artificial intelligence. As digital infrastructure grows, employers require software engineers who can build scalable applications, manage distributed systems, and support global users. Because local talent shortages persist, companies increasingly recruit internationally and sponsor work visas for qualified candidates.
Key Takeaways
- Software engineer visa sponsorship jobs in USA are widely available across the US, UK, Canada, and Europe
- Backend, cloud, and full-stack engineers have the highest sponsorship demand
- Strong portfolios and real-world projects improve international hiring chances
- Tech companies, startups, and consulting firms frequently sponsor software engineers
- Salaries for sponsored roles are competitive with relocation and long-term benefits

Why Software Engineer Visa Sponsorship Jobs Are in High Demand
Software engineers are essential to modern business operations. Companies rely on developers to build platforms, automate workflows, and maintain infrastructure. The shortage of experienced engineers has pushed employers to expand hiring globally.
Key demand drivers:
- Cloud computing adoption
- Artificial intelligence and automation
- Mobile-first application development
- SaaS platform growth
- Cybersecurity requirements
- Digital transformation initiatives
These factors create strong opportunities for international candidates seeking sponsored roles.
Countries Offering Software Engineer Visa Sponsorship Jobs
United States
The United States offers some of the highest-paying software engineering roles. Companies sponsor through H-1B visas, employment-based green cards, and internal transfers.
Average salary range:
- Entry-level: $80,000 – $100,000
- Mid-level: $100,000 – $140,000
- Senior-level: $140,000 – $190,000+
Common roles:
- Software Engineer
- Backend Developer
- Full Stack Engineer
- Cloud Engineer
- DevOps Engineer
United Kingdom
The UK Skilled Worker visa allows employers to sponsor software engineers.
Salary range:
- Entry-level: £32,000 – £45,000
- Mid-level: £45,000 – £70,000
- Senior-level: £70,000 – £100,000
Canada
Canada offers strong immigration pathways for software engineers.
Salary range:
- Entry-level: CAD 70,000 – 85,000
- Mid-level: CAD 85,000 – 110,000
- Senior-level: CAD 110,000 – 140,000
Australia
Australia hires software engineers under skilled migration programs.
Salary range:
- Entry-level: AUD 75,000 – 95,000
- Mid-level: AUD 95,000 – 125,000
- Senior-level: AUD 125,000 – 160,000
Germany and Europe
Germany and EU countries provide Blue Card visas for software engineers.
Salary range:
- Entry-level: €50,000 – €65,000
- Mid-level: €65,000 – €90,000
- Senior-level: €90,000 – €130,000
Types of Software Engineer Visa Sponsorship Jobs
Backend Software Engineer
Responsibilities:
- API development
- Server architecture
- Database management
- Performance optimization
Technologies:
- Java
- Python
- Node.js
- Go
- .NET
Frontend Software Engineer
Responsibilities:
- UI development
- Web performance
- Responsive design
- User experience
Technologies:
- JavaScript
- React
- Angular
- Vue
- TypeScript
Full Stack Software Engineer
Responsibilities:
- Frontend and backend development
- API integration
- Database design
- Application deployment
Cloud Software Engineer
Responsibilities:
- Cloud architecture
- Microservices
- Deployment automation
- Infrastructure scaling
Tools:
- AWS
- Azure
- Google Cloud
- Docker
- Kubernetes
DevOps Engineer
Responsibilities:
- CI/CD pipelines
- Infrastructure automation
- Monitoring
- Deployment
Qualifications Required for Software Engineer Sponsorship Jobs
Typical requirements:
- Degree in Computer Science or related field
- OR equivalent experience
- Programming knowledge
- Data structures understanding
- Problem solving skills
- Git experience
Preferred:
- Portfolio projects
- Open-source contributions
- Internship experience
- System design knowledge
Programming Languages in High Demand
Most requested:
- JavaScript
- Python
- Java
- C#
- Go
- TypeScript
- Kotlin
- Rust
Frameworks:
- React
- Node.js
- Spring Boot
- Django
- .NET Core
- Angular
Skills That Increase Visa Sponsorship Chances
Technical skills:
- Microservices architecture
- REST APIs
- GraphQL
- Cloud deployment
- Containerization
- CI/CD pipelines
- Database design
- Authentication systems
Soft skills:
- Communication
- Collaboration
- Agile development
- Problem solving
- Documentation
Companies Hiring Software Engineers With Visa Sponsorship
Industries hiring globally:
- Technology companies
- Fintech firms
- SaaS companies
- Consulting companies
- AI startups
- E-commerce companies
- Cloud providers
These employers sponsor skilled engineers.
How to Find Software Engineer Visa Sponsorship Jobs
Step 1: Use Sponsorship Keywords
Search for:
- Software engineer visa sponsorship
- Backend engineer visa
- Full stack engineer sponsorship
- Cloud engineer visa
Step 2: Apply to Global Companies
Focus on:
- Multinational tech companies
- Remote-first startups
- Consulting firms
Step 3: Build Strong Portfolio
Include:
- Full-stack applications
- APIs
- Cloud deployments
- Microservices projects
- Real-world apps
Step 4: Optimize Resume
Highlight:
- Programming languages
- Frameworks
- Projects
- Achievements
- Performance improvements
Example:
“Reduced API latency by 40% using caching”
Interview Questions for Software Engineer Sponsorship Jobs
Common questions:
- Explain REST API
- What is microservices architecture?
- Difference between SQL and NoSQL
- What is Docker?
- Explain multithreading
- How does caching work?
Prepare coding and system design questions.
Visa Types for Software Engineer Jobs
United States:
- H1B visa
- EB2 visa
- EB3 visa
United Kingdom:
- Skilled Worker visa
Canada:
- Express Entry
- LMIA permit
Australia:
- Skilled migration visa
Germany:
- EU Blue Card
Entry-Level Software Engineer Visa Sponsorship Jobs
Entry-level roles:
- Junior software engineer
- Graduate developer
- Associate software engineer
- Junior backend developer
- Frontend junior developer
Freshers qualify with projects.
Remote Software Engineer Sponsorship Jobs
Remote-first companies hire globally.
Roles include:
- Remote backend engineer
- Remote full stack developer
- Remote cloud engineer
- Remote frontend developer
Benefits:
- Work remotely first
- Relocation later
- International exposure
Salary Comparison for Sponsored Software Engineers
Top-paying regions:
- United States
- Switzerland
- Canada
- Australia
- UK
Salary grows with experience.
Best Projects to Get Sponsorship
Build projects like:
- E-commerce platform
- REST API system
- Chat application
- Authentication system
- Microservices project
These demonstrate ability.
Career Growth After Sponsorship Job
Career path:
Junior Engineer → Software Engineer → Senior Engineer → Tech Lead → Engineering Manager
Specializations:
- Cloud engineering
- DevOps
- AI engineering
- Backend architecture
- Security engineering
Benefits of Software Engineer Visa Sponsorship Jobs
- High salary packages
- Work abroad legally
- Permanent residency pathways
- Relocation support
- Career growth
- Global experience
- Modern technology exposure
Challenges to Expect
- Coding interviews
- System design rounds
- Visa processing
- Competition
- Relocation planning
Preparation increases success rate.
Where to Apply for Software Engineer Visa Sponsorship Jobs
Apply on:
- LinkedIn Jobs
- Indeed
- Glassdoor
- Stack Overflow Jobs
- Company career pages
Use filters:
- “Visa sponsorship”
- “International applicants”
- “Work visa available”
Final Thoughts
Software engineer visa sponsorship jobs provide strong opportunities for international developers seeking global careers. Companies worldwide need skilled engineers to build scalable systems, maintain infrastructure, and support digital growth. Because of talent shortages, employers actively sponsor qualified candidates.
Start by strengthening programming skills, building real-world projects, and preparing for coding interviews. Apply to multinational companies and sponsorship-friendly employers. Entry-level candidates also have opportunities with strong portfolios and practical experience.
With consistent effort, software engineering roles can lead to international employment, high salaries, and long-term career growth.
FAQs
1. Can I get software engineer visa sponsorship as a fresher?
Yes. Many companies hire junior engineers with strong portfolios, GitHub projects, and coding skills.
2. Which software engineer role is easiest for visa sponsorship?
Backend and full-stack engineering roles usually have the highest demand.
3. Do I need a degree for software engineer sponsorship?
Not always. Skills, projects, and experience can replace formal education.
4. Which country is best for software engineer visa sponsorship?
Canada, Germany, and the UK offer easier pathways, while the US offers higher salaries.
5. What salary do sponsored software engineers earn?
Entry-level sponsored engineers typically earn between $80,000 and $100,000 depending on country.